Milk Allergy in baby

8 replies

ZoeJe · 03/08/2021 14:42

Hi
My baby started coming up in hives so we changed to Aptimal pepti milk. 5 days in and still hives.

What could be the ingredient that remains that we need to remove from her diet?

lolly999 · 03/08/2021 20:30

Aptamil pepti still has cows milk in, just with the proteins broken down. My son's symptoms didn't improve on it either, so we were put on SMA Alfamino. You need that or neocate as they have no milk in at all x

Dugi3 · 03/08/2021 21:40

Definitely neocate, although any trace of milk can take a good while to fully clear the system which is why we were told to trial the formula for at least 14 days to give a true reflection of its effectiveness.
